UIA: Fix GetVisibleRanges() and add Tracing (#4495)
## Summary of the Pull Request
Debugging our custom UIA providers has been a painful experience because outputting content to VS may result in UIA Clients getting impatient and giving up on extracting data.

Adding tracing allows us to debug these providers without getting in the way of reproducing a bug. This will help immensely with developing accessibility features on Windows Terminal and Console.

This pull request additionally contains payload from #4526:
* Make GetVisibleRanges() return one range (and add tracing for it).
`ScreenInfoUiaProvider::GetVisibleRanges()` used to return one range per line of visible text. The documentation for this function says that we should return one per contiguous span of text. Since all of the text in the TermControl will always be contiguous (at least by our standards), we should only ever be returning one range.

## Detailed Description of the Pull Request / Additional comments
`UiaTracing` is a singleton class that is in charge of registration for trace logging. `TextRange` is used to trace `UiaTextRange`, whereas `TextProvider` is used to trace `ScreenInfoUiaProviderBase`.

`_getValue()` is overloaded to transform complex objects and enums into a string for logging.

`_getTextValue()` had to be added to be able to trace the text a UiaTextRange included. This makes following UiaTextRanges much simpler.

/*++
Copyright (c) Microsoft Corporation
Licensed under the MIT license.
Module Name:
- tracing.hpp
Abstract:
- This module is used for recording tracing/debugging information to the telemetry ETW channel
- The data is not automatically broadcast to telemetry backends as it does not set the TELEMETRY keyword.
- NOTE: Many functions in this file appear to be copy/pastes. This is because the TraceLog documentation warns
to not be "cute" in trying to reduce its macro usages with variables as it can cause unexpected behavior.
Author(s):
- Michael Niksa (miniksa) 25-Nov-2014
--*/
#pragma once
#include <functional>
#include "../types/inc/Viewport.hpp"
#if DBG
#define DBGCHARS(_params_) \
{ \
Tracing::s_TraceChars _params_; \
}
#define DBGOUTPUT(_params_) \
{ \
Tracing::s_TraceOutput _params_; \
}
#else
#define DBGCHARS(_params_)
#define DBGOUTPUT(_params_)
#endif
class Tracing
{
public:
~Tracing();
static Tracing s_TraceApiCall(const NTSTATUS& result, PCSTR traceName);
static void s_TraceApi(const NTSTATUS status, const CONSOLE_GETLARGESTWINDOWSIZE_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(const NTSTATUS status, const CONSOLE_SCREENBUFFERINFO_MSG* const a, const bool fSet);
static void s_TraceApi(const NTSTATUS status, const CONSOLE_SETSCREENBUFFERSIZE_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(const NTSTATUS status, const CONSOLE_SETWINDOWINFO_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(_In_ const void* const buffer, const CONSOLE_WRITECONSOLE_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(const CONSOLE_SCREENBUFFERINFO_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(const CONSOLE_MODE_MSG* const a, const std::wstring& handleType);
static void s_TraceApi(const CONSOLE_SETTEXTATTRIBUTE_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ceApi(const CONSOLE_WRITECONSOLEOUTPUTSTRING_MSG* const a);
static void s_TraceWindowViewport(const Microsoft::Console::Types::Viewport& viewport);
static void s_TraceChars(_In_z_ const char* pszMessage, ...);
static void s_TraceOutput(_In_z_ const char* pszMessage, ...);
static void s_TraceWindowMessage(const MSG& msg);
static void s_TraceInputRecord(const INPUT_RECORD& inputRecord);
static void __stdcall TraceFailure(const wil::FailureInfo& failure) noexcept;
private:
static ULONG s_ulDebugFlag;
Tracing(std::function<void()> onExit);
std::function<void()> _onExit;
};
